UFV’s Explore Trades Sampler program is ideal for students, young adults, or women wishing to learn practical skills, gain general employment certifications, and explore trades careers.

This program is a unique opportunity to explore a variety of trades—including Automotive Service, Carpentry,  Electrical, Plumbing and Piping, and Welding—and to acquire basic skills that will prove fundamental if you decide to become a tradesperson. At the end of the program, you are certified in Forklift Truck, First Aid, and Workplace Hazardous Material Information System (WHMIS), and you are ready to enter trade foundation training or seek an apprenticeship in the trade of your choice.
